So who are LUBECO New Zealand? LUBECO make and distribute a wide range of high performance, readily biodegradable lubricants. They are specifically developed for forestry and the wood processing industry, where release of mineral oils and lubricants into the natural environment is best avoided. Their products have been the leading bio-lubricants for more than 20 years and the range covers: Oils for “total loss” lubrication of chain saws, stationary power saws, harvesters, lathes and conveyor belts, etc. A full range of vegetable based hydraulic oils [HETG specification] and fully synthetic hydraulic oils [HEES specification], gear oils and synthetic universal greasing oils [UTTO specification]. These products can be used in a vast range of forestry applications as they out-perform the usual mineral oil based lubricants. They are non-toxic, and of course user and environment friendly. All LUBECO products are manufactured in standard viscosity ranges and these can also be customised for individual requirements. A big question for any environmentally conscious consumer would be what are these oils made from and what is the process that goes into their manufacture? The LUBECO vegetable based lubricants are manufactured mainly from cold pressed rapeseed and hi-oleic sunflower. Cold pressing produces an oil with unique properties necessary for high performance technical applications. The naturally present vitamin E is an anti-oxidant and protects against polymerization. All LUBECO synthetic oils are made from a combination of of saturated and unsaturated fatty acids that have excellent performance and anti-oxidative parameters. Also the thermal properties are much greater [pour point up to -50 ° C]. After refining the oils are blended and additives are incorporated according to individual requirements and particular applications.
